
【計】 transaction batch user
general affairs; pidgin; routine; work
【經】 general affairs; rush hour
【計】 batch processing; processing batch
【經】 batch processing
consumer; user
【計】 SUB; U
【經】 consumer; consumer buyer; ultimate purchaser; user
事務成批處理用戶(Transaction Batch Processing User)指在計算機系統中,将多個獨立事務整合為批量任務進行處理的操作者或系統角色。其核心特征是通過集中提交代替實時單次處理,以優化資源利用率。
“事務”指獨立操作單元(如訂單提交),“成批處理”強調批量聚合(如每日彙總更新),“用戶”包含人工操作員或自動化程式。
Transaction(事務)、Batch Processing(成批處理)、User(用戶),組合後體現批量任務執行主體的職能 。
批量處理減少系統頻繁啟停開銷,提升CPU/I/O效率,適用于銀行日終結算、電商訂單集中發貨等場景(IBM技術文檔指出批量處理可降低30%系統負載。
成批事務可統一回滾,避免單點故障擴散。如Oracle數據庫的批處理機制支持事務組原子性提交。
適用于非實時需求場景,如企業月度報表生成(Microsoft Azure批處理服務案例。
用戶類别 | 代表角色 | 操作目标 |
---|---|---|
系統管理員 | 數據庫運維人員 | 定時執行數據備份/遷移 |
企業財務人員 | 會計結算專員 | 日終批量處理收支流水 |
自動化程式 | 腳本/Scheduler任務 | 周期性觸發報表生成 |
IEEE《Transaction Processing Concepts》界定批處理為“非交互式的事務序列執行模式”,強調其與聯機處理的互補性。
金融行業ISO 20022标準要求批量支付處理需滿足ACID特性(原子性、一緻性、隔離性、持久性)。
注:以上來源鍊接因平台限制未展示,可依據文獻名稱檢索IEEE Xplore、IBM Developer、Microsoft Docs等權威平台獲取原文。
“事務成批處理”是數據庫管理系統中的一種操作方式,結合了“事務”和“批量處理”兩個核心概念,主要用于保障數據完整性與提升操作效率。以下是詳細解釋:
事務(Transaction)
指一組不可分割的數據庫操作序列,需滿足ACID特性(原子性、一緻性、隔離性、持久性)。例如轉賬操作需同時完成扣款和入賬,否則全部回滾。
成批處理(Batch Processing)
指将多個獨立操作集中後一次性執行,常用于處理周期性任務或大規模數據操作。例如批量導入用戶數據。
原子性
所有操作要麼全部成功,要麼全部失敗。例如批量更新100條記錄時,若第50條出錯,已執行的49條也會回滾。
效率提升
通過減少與數據庫的交互次數(如網絡延遲、I/O開銷)提高性能。例如一次性提交1000條SQL語句而非逐條執行。
數據一緻性
确保批量操作前後的數據庫狀态符合業務邏輯約束,如庫存數量不能為負數。
通過這種機制,事務成批處理在保證數據可靠性的同時,顯著優化了數據庫操作的執行效率。
本國并行系統查找文件觸發字得到學位電波多色按蚊房屋漆分子間能量傳遞國際收支業務後下小葉黃堇鹼徽型器件堿金屬潤滑脂計劃調節和市場調節相結合鏡像物科學問題勒讓德條件鍊式聚合利尿鹽鳥嘌呤偶極子平方取中法前置組件妊娠剩磁聽像通融橢圓偏振外部汽提段